📌 on 함수란?

  • 하나의 요소에 여러 이벤트를 동시에 적용할 수 있는 jQuery 메서드

 

✅ 여러 요소에 동일 이벤트 적용

$("#box01, #box02").on("click", function() {
    alert($("#box01").val() + $("#box02").val());
});

 

  • #box01, #box02 두 요소에 동시에 click 이벤트를 적용
  • click 시 두 요소의 값을 합쳐서 알림(alert) 표시

 

 

✅ 여러 이벤트를 한 요소에 적용

$(selector).on({ 
    click: function() { 
        // 클릭 시 실행할 함수 
    },
    change: function() { 
        // 변경 시 실행할 함수 
    },
    mouseenter: function() { 
        // 마우스 엔터 시 실행할 함수 
    }
});

 

  • click, change, mouseenter 등 여러 이벤트를 한 번에 지정 가능
  • 각 이벤트마다 별도의 함수를 설정 가능

 

'프론트엔드 > JQuery' 카테고리의 다른 글

[JQuery] print() 화면 프린트 하기  (0) 2021.07.05
[JQuery] Ajax 답변삭제 팝업  (0) 2021.06.16
[JQuery] Ajax  (0) 2021.06.11
[JQuery] 부트스트랩 - Carousel(캐러셀) 만들기  (0) 2021.06.05
[JQuery] 클릭 이벤트  (0) 2021.05.25

+ Recent posts